Several key skills are becoming more important as businesses navigate the complexities of online marketing. Here are some crucial skills you should focus on:
- Analytical Skills: To succeed in SEO marketing jobs, you need to analyze data regularly. This includes understanding website traffic, behavior patterns, and keyword performance.
- Technical SEO Knowledge: Familiarity with HTML, CSS, and JavaScript can set you apart. Knowing how to optimize site speed, architecture, and mobile-friendliness is vital.
- Content Creation: Great SEO starts with quality content. You should be skilled in creating engaging, relevant, and actionable content that incorporates keywords effectively.
- Link Building: Understanding strategies to acquire backlinks is crucial. Quality inbound links can significantly enhance your site’s authority.
- Adaptability: The SEO landscape changes frequently. Staying updated on algorithm changes and emerging trends is necessary to remain effective.
As digital channels continue to evolve, some trends will shape the future of SEO marketing jobs. Here are some key trends to monitor:
Voice Search Optimization
With the increasing use of voice-activated assistants like Siri and Alexa, optimizing for voice search is essential. This means focusing on natural language, answering questions directly, and targeting long-tail keywords that match conversational queries.
Mobile-First Indexing
Google primarily uses mobile versions of content for indexing and ranking. Therefore, SEO marketing professionals must ensure that websites are mobile-friendly. This includes responsive design and fast loading times.
User Experience (UX)
User experience is becoming a significant factor in SEO rankings. Keeping visitors engaged, ensuring easy navigation, and providing useful content enhances UX. Good UX results in lower bounce rates and higher organic rankings.
AI and Automation
Artificial intelligence (AI) has a growing influence on SEO. Tools using AI can analyze vast amounts of data to predict search trends, suggest optimizations, and even automate certain tasks. Professionals in SEO marketing should learn how to leverage these technologies to improve efficiency.

Local SEO Optimization
As more consumers search for local businesses online, local SEO is gaining importance. Employing strategies that enhance local search visibility can give businesses an edge. This includes optimizing Google My Business listings and acquiring local backlinks.
Many businesses are now focusing on hiring professionals who can blend these skills and trends effectively. Here are some roles in SEO marketing jobs that you might explore:
- SEO Analyst: Focus on data analysis and interpretation to improve search rankings.
- Content Marketing Specialist: Create and promote valuable content to attract and engage the target audience.
- SEO Consultant: Provide expertise and guidance on SEO best practices and strategies.
- Link Building Specialist: Focus primarily on building quality backlinks to improve domain authority.
- SEO Manager: Oversee SEO strategy and teams to ensure company goals are met.

Understand the Basics of SEO
First and foremost, it’s crucial to grasp the fundamental concepts of SEO. You should familiarize yourself with terms such as:
- Keywords – the words and phrases that users type into search engines.
- On-page SEO – optimizing individual pages to rank higher.
- Off-page SEO – building backlinks and increasing authority.
- Technical SEO – ensuring that search engines can crawl and index your site effectively.
By understanding these basics, you’ll be able to engage in conversations about SEO with more confidence.

Get Hands-On Experience
Theoretical knowledge is great, but practical experience is crucial. Here are some ways to gain hands-on experience:
- Start a Blog: Create your own blog and optimize it for SEO. This will give you real-life experience applying what you learn.
- Volunteer: Offer to help small businesses with their SEO for free or at a reduced rate. This will not only build your portfolio but also provide practical insights.
- Internships: Look for internships related to digital marketing. They often provide a great introduction to additional marketing strategies alongside SEO.
Take Advantage of Online Courses
In today’s digital age, many affordable and even free resources are available to help you learn SEO effectively. Here are some recommended platforms:
- Google Digital Garage: Offers free courses that cover the essentials of digital marketing.
- Coursera: Provides a variety of courses from leading universities and companies.
- Udemy: Features numerous SEO-focused courses that often have excellent reviews.
Completing these courses not only enhances your skills but also adds credibility to your resume.
Network Effectively
Networking can significantly impact your career path in SEO marketing. You can connect with professionals in several ways:
- Social Media: Engage with SEO communities on platforms like LinkedIn and Twitter. Share insights, comment on posts, and learn from others.
- Meetups and Conferences: Attend local or virtual SEO meetups and industry conferences. These events provide an opportunity to meet potential mentors and employers.
- Online Forums: Participate in SEO forums like Moz and Reddit, where you can ask questions and share your knowledge.
Craft a Strong Resume and Portfolio
Your resume should reflect not just your educational background but also your hands-on experience, including the projects you’ve worked on. Highlight your skills in:
- Keyword research
- Content optimization
- Analytics tools (like Google Analytics)
- Technical SEO knowledge
Consider creating a portfolio showcasing your best work or case studies from personal or volunteer projects. A solid portfolio speaks volumes to potential employers.

Stay Updated with Industry Trends
SEO is constantly evolving, so keeping abreast of the latest trends is essential. Here’s how you can stay informed:
- Subscribe to SEO Blogs: Follow reputable blogs like Moz, Search Engine Journal, and Ahrefs for industry news and tips.
- Listen to Podcasts: Engage with SEO podcasts to learn on the go.
- Join Webinars: Attend webinars on current SEO topics to deepen your expertise.
By staying informed, you not only enhance your skills but also demonstrate to employers that you are proactive and dedicated to your field.
